Reopening & Reimagining Educational Facilities Amid COVID-19

As a second wave of the pandemic hits the U.S., many school administrators are wondering whether their facilities are prepared to receive students full time or whether they should extend virtual classes into the fall. While the timing of reopening is up for debate, what isn’t is the need to ensure that K-12 schools and colleges and universities are ready when the time comes.

This webinar will explore the strategies school administrators and staff should take prior to reopening the classroom, as well as a discussion as to how the coronavirus pandemic will change the way we design schools in the future.

Learning Objectives:

  1. Describe current challenges with safely reopening educational facilities amid the pandemic.
  2. Identify key operations and maintenance procedures that need to be addressed prior to reopening schools.
  3. Explain proper cleaning protocols that adhere to CDC guidelines to protect occupant health.
  4. Evaluate the effectiveness of design strategies to reorganize and reimagine classrooms for learning and physical distancing.
